The base fabric is a high-quality cloth called Paño - Glasgow, composed of 93% polyester, 5% viscose, and 2% elastane, with a weight of 380 gr/m2 and a width of 150 cm. The design, printed using sublimation technology on the fabric surface, features a botanical and decorative style with a floral nature consisting of roses and other multicolored flowers. The fabric texture is soft to the touch, making it pleasant for use in garments such as coats, jackets, vests, blazers, and cardigans.
The printed design can be combined with other solid colors such as olive green, beige, or black, making it easily adaptable to different styles and environments. The single-sided printed fabric allows the design to be fully appreciated, as there is no loss of detail on the back surface.
Regarding general characteristics, the Glasgow cloth is resistant and durable, making it ideal for applications in altars and coasters in the home. On the other hand, the printed design adds personality and style to clothing and fashion accessories.
The use of this fabric must follow certain care recommendations, such as not bleaching, not dry cleaning, ironing at a warm temperature, and not using a tumble dryer. These cares will extend the life of the fabric and maintain the quality of the printed design.
The printing technology used is sublimation, which allows the digital design to be transferred to the fabric with great precision and quality. This printing technique is carried out by heating the paper with the printed design and the base fabric to a certain temperature so that the dye sublimates from the paper to the fabric surface. This achieves a permanent print resistant to washing.
